The Old Man of the Mountain was a series of rocky ledges composed of granite, a type of igneous rock. Granite is a common rock type found in mountainous regions due to its durability and resistance to weathering.

Metacronglomerate is a type of rock that is usually found in regions of high-grade metamorphic activity, such as mountain belts or regions that have experienced intense tectonic activity. It is formed from the metamorphism of conglomerate rock, and can often be found in the cores of mountain ranges or in shield areas.

Regions near mountains can have variable climates, often with cooler temperatures due to higher elevations and increased precipitation due to orographic lifting. This can result in diverse microclimates within a relatively small area, with differences in temperature, precipitation, and vegetation depending on factors like aspect and proximity to the mountain range. This can create unique ecosystems and weather patterns in mountainous regions.
The geography of the state of Wyoming includes plains regions, numerous mountain ranges, and basins. Other features include buttes, rivers and prairies.
